Police & Fire: Assaults reported to Battle Creek police

ASSAULTS: Battle Creek police have reported the following cases: • A boy, 9, told officers he was punched in the arm by another young boy and his $700 cell phone was taken in the 100 block of Post Avenue at 7:31 p.m. Friday. • A warrant is being sought for a man, 31, after his roommate, a man, 39, said he was assaulted in the first block of North Mason Avenue at 9:20 p.m. Monday. • A man, 24, was arrested after his girlfriend, 22, said she was assaulted when he hit her with a diaper bag in the 100 block of James Street at 10:06 p.m. Monday. • A man, 28, was arrested when his friend s roommate, 33, said he was assaulted in the 1000 block of Capital Avenue Southwest at 10 p.m. Monday.

Police & Fire: Catalytic converters stolen near Marshall

CAT CONVERTERS: Catalytic converters were stolen from several vehicles near Marshall on Friday. Michigan State Police at Marshall said the thefts were between 8 a.m. and 1 p.m. from vehicles parked at the Michigan Department of Transportation carpool lot, also known as Park & Ride, at 15720 Michigan Ave. at the I-69 interchange. The catalytic converters are emission control devices that contain the valuable metals platinum, rhodium and palladium, which can be sold. Police across Michigan have reported increased thefts this year. Police say thieves can crawl under vehicles and remove the converters within a few minutes. The carpool lot near Marshall is one of 243 in Michigan. MSP investigate Monday night St Joseph County barn fire

Coldwater, MI, USA / WTVB | 1590 AM · 95.5 FM | The Voice of Branch County Jan 21, 2021 5:32 AM FLOWERFIELD TOWNSHIP, MI (WTVB) – A Monday night barn fire in St. Joseph County is being investigated by the Michigan State Police as it’s believed the fire was intentionally set. It took place in the 11000 block of Mt. Zion Road which is northwest of Three Rivers. State Police say there may have been suspicious people and vehicles in the area just prior to the fire starting. The barn which was built in the 1800’s was almost a complete loss. Anyone with information is asked to contact the Michigan State Police in Marshall at (269) 558-0500.
